Design and Portability

The NDYIN Portable Printer is designed for mobility, weighing only 1.5 pounds and featuring a built-in rechargeable battery that can print up to 160 sheets after a full charge. This makes it an excellent choice for business travelers or anyone needing to print documents on the go. In contrast, the SUPVAN E10, while also portable, is primarily a label maker, which means its design is focused more on functionality for home and office organization rather than extensive printing capabilities.

Printing Technology and Quality

The NDYIN Portable Printer uses direct thermal technology, which eliminates the need for ink, toner, or ribbons. This not only makes it environmentally friendly but also cost-effective in the long run. It offers high-definition printing quality with a resolution of 203 DPI, ensuring clear and crisp prints. The SUPVAN E10, on the other hand, is an inkless label maker that produces waterproof, oil-proof labels suitable for various environments, but it doesn’t offer the same breadth of printing options as the NDYIN.

Application Versatility

The NDYIN Portable Printer supports printing from multiple devices, including smartphones and laptops, via Bluetooth and USB-C. It’s suitable for printing documents, contracts, and invoices, making it versatile for both personal and professional use. In contrast, the SUPVAN E10 is tailored for home and office organization, allowing users to create labels for storage, identification, and supplies. Battery Life and Charging

The NDYIN Portable Printer features a robust 2600mAh rechargeable battery, enabling it to print a significant number of sheets before needing a recharge. This makes it ideal for those who require a reliable printing solution while traveling. The SUPVAN E10 also boasts a rechargeable battery, which lasts a month on a single charge, but it serves a different function as a label maker. Users should consider how often they print when evaluating battery life.

User Experience and Ease of Use

The NDYIN Portable Printer requires the installation of a driver for laptop connectivity, adding a layer of complexity for some users. However, it does offer a straightforward Bluetooth connection for mobile devices with the "Nada Print" App. Meanwhile, the SUPVAN E10 is designed for simplicity, requiring no fees or registration for its app. Users can quickly customize their labels with a variety of fonts and icons without any extra steps, making it an excellent choice for those who prioritize ease of use.
